This study aimed to investigate the reality of using Crocodile virtual laboratories in teaching practical experiments in chemistry and physics from the teachers' point of view. To conduct the study, the researchers used the descriptive survey method. For this purpose, the researchers designed a questionnaire consisting of 21 items distributed over four axes, including the areas of planning and implementing practical experiments lessons, evaluating practical skills, and obstacles to using virtual laboratories. The questionnaire was applied to a sample of 52 teachers from the chemistry and physics majors who are affiliated to the Qunfdhah Education Administration in the third semester of the academic year 1443 AH. After the statistical analysis of the data, the results showed the agreement of the research sample of chemistry and physics teachers that virtual laboratories help to teach practical experiments effectively in the field of planning and implementing practical experiments lessons and evaluating practical skills, They also agreed on the obstacles that limit the effective use of virtual laboratories, the most prominent of which was the limited number of computers required to use these laboratories and the weak technical support accompanying the use of these laboratories, and there is no statistically significant difference between the responses due to specialization. In light of the results, the researchers came up with a number of recommendations and suggestions. (Published abstract)
